Flickingeria aureiloba (J.J.Sm.) J.J.Wood 1982

Plant and Flower Photo by Dian Rahardjo ©,

Common Name The Golden Lobed Flickingeria

Flower Size .6" [1.5 cm]

Found in Java and Sumatra on lava rocks at elevations of 600 to to 1000 meters as a medium szied, hot to warm growing lithophyte with 3.2" [8 cm] between each much branched stem carrying compressed pseduobulbs 3 to 3.6" apart carrying a single apical, erect, lanceolate, very shortly bilobed apically, basally narrowing, shining green above, paler below leaf that blooms in the spring from the front and the back of each leaf on a short to .35" [9 mm], single to 3 flowered inflorescence carrying flowers that only last half a day but are sweetly scented.

Synonyms Dendrobium aureilobum J.J.Sm. 1921; Ephemerantha aureiloba (J.J.Sm.) P.F.Hunt & Summerh.1961

References W3 Tropicos, Kew Monocot list , IPNI ; Orchids of Java Comber 1990; Orchid Of Sumatra Comber 2001;
